I have a 2012 so 190with 225 hours. Been running great the past few weeks. Today it was running fine for a hour and then I put in like 5 feet of water and just floated. Then I was going back to pull a tuber and with the throttle fully down I was only getting 6000-6500 rpms but I can normally get 8k plus. I was only getting to 30 mph when I can normally go 40 plus.

I was messing with the clean out port before we went tubing again and I made sure I put it fully back in.

Any ideas what could be wrong?
 
Check the throttle cable to see if it slipped.
 
The engine definitely sounds different when running now. Lots of gargling when sitting in neutral or slow speed and when running at medium to full throttle it doesn’t sound normal.
 
Did you check your air filter to see if it is clean? Overfilling the oil during an oil change can result in a oily air filter
 
Air filter seems fine
 
Also check to see if something is in the jet pump... could be anything small
 
Ok I will look again. I tried loooing to see if anything was in there. Didn’t seem like it
 
Ok I will look again. I tried loooing to see if anything was in there. Didn’t seem like it
I've had a remarkably small piece of driftwood caught in mine causing problems. I would say roughly 2-3 times the size of a toothpick in thickness. It was super small.

Caught a piece of wood on the river, used the cleanout port to get it out, thought all was well. I was getting full RPM, but not full thrust, so slightly different case. I checked cleanout again, and pulled this tiny little piece out. Boat ran better, but still not 100%. Then like someone walked up and kicked the back of my seat, the pump must have spit something else out because I took off like a rocket at ~25mph or so.
